Output ab334ebfe030895e6c8f58bd0399e4f41250cddf2544ea6c5eaabb1cbe621436:1

value
43622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c966fbd1e8e55f4afaae46144820c6ed5893ff OP_EQUAL
address
394BFZn2SmKVpksxtkpPs1VYUEbhQJeFU7
transaction
ab334ebfe030895e6c8f58bd0399e4f41250cddf2544ea6c5eaabb1cbe621436
spent
true